Core Viewpoint - The real estate market in Guangzhou's Zengcheng district is experiencing significant price declines, with the price per square meter for properties in the Helenburg Garden dropping from 21,019 yuan to 7,752 yuan, representing a 63.1% decrease over four years [1][6]. Price Trends - In 2021, a 95.63 square meter apartment in Helenburg Garden sold for a total price of 2.01 million yuan, reflecting the peak of the market [1]. - By 2025, a similar apartment in the same complex sold for only 73.8 thousand yuan, indicating a drastic drop in property values [6]. - Other properties in Zengcheng, such as Minjie Green Lake Mansion, have also seen price reductions, with current listings averaging 8,500 yuan per square meter, down from an opening price of 11,000 yuan [6]. Market Sentiment - Online discussions reveal skepticism about the previous price surges, with comments suggesting that the market was driven by irrational exuberance [7]. - Observers note that the current price corrections are a return to rationality in the market, as buyers become more discerning [7]. Overall Market Conditions - Recent data from the Guangzhou Housing and Urban-Rural Development Bureau indicates a 26.4% year-on-year increase in new home transaction area during the National Day holiday, although the overall market sentiment remains cautious [9]. - The Central Plains Research Development Department reported a significant drop in new home purchases year-on-year, despite a doubling of transactions compared to the previous month [11]. - The market is characterized by a lack of strong supportive policies this year, leading to lower buyer confidence and a more cautious approach among potential homebuyers [12]. Future Outlook - Industry experts predict that the transaction volume in the fourth quarter will remain high due to developers' promotional efforts and government support measures [13]. - The overall market is expected to stabilize, with prices entering a phase of rational fluctuation, providing opportunities for first-time buyers [12][13].
